    Description

    In addition to a new 8 page, full-color insert, this third edition of NASCAR For Dummies offers readers information on recent changes in technology such as the “Car of Tomorrow” and updates to the information that has made previous editions of NASCAR For Dummies a must-have guide for fans of this exciting sport.

Whether you’re new to this exciting sport or a longtime fan, this insider’s guide covers everything you want to know in detail — from the anatomy of a stock car to the strategies used by top drivers in the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series.What’s new with NASCAR? — get the latest on the new racing rules, teams, drivers, car designs, and safety requirementsA crash course in stock-car racing — meet the teams and sponsors, understand the different NASCAR series, and find out how drivers get started in the racing businessTake a test drive — explore a stock car inside and out, learn the rules of the track, and work with the race teamUnderstand the driver’s world — get inside a driver’s head and see what happens before, during, and after a raceKeep track of NASCAR events — from the stands or the comfort of home, follow the sport and get the most out of each raceOpen the book and find:Top driver Mark Martin’s personal insights into the sportThe lowdown on each NASCAR trackWhy drivers are true athletesExplanations of NASCAR lingoHow to win a race (it’s more than just driving fast!)What happens during a pit stopHow to fit in with a NASCAR crowdTen can’t-miss races of the yearNASCAR statistics, race car numbers, and milestones About the Author Mark Martin burst onto the NASCAR scene in 1981 after earning four American Speed Association championships, and has been winning races and setting records ever since. Considered by many to be the greatest active NASCAR Sprint Cup Series driver without a championship, Martin will vie for the 2009 title behind the wheel of the No. 5 Kellogg’s/CARQUEST Chevrolet.

    ⭐I bought this book because my son is a fan of NASCAR, of which I knew nothing until I bought the book.It is very interesting and informative.The information is also of the type you don’t realize you need. For instance, there are many tips on going to an actual race–from buying tickets (buy early but not infield) to sitting in the stands (bring sunscreen and a cushion and no umbrellas)to bothering the racers (how to do it).We enjoyed the book and it added to our enjoyment of the big weekend at Watkins Glen.BootsO’Rourke
